# Labreador > Free, browser-based bioassay analysis platform for ELISA standard curves (4PL/5PL), IC50/EC50 dose-response fitting, relative potency (parallel line analysis), kinetic assay reduction with group statistics, and ecotoxicology indices. No account, no paywall, zero data upload — every calculation runs locally in the user's browser and works offline. Labreador is aimed at life-science researchers, analytical labs, QC/biosimilar potency work, and environmental scientists. Zenodo. https://doi.org/10.5281/zenodo.21676846 ## What it calculates - **ELISA**: blank subtraction, 4PL/5PL/linear/quadratic standard curve fitting, sample concentration interpolation, dilution factors, replicate CV%, LLOQ/ULOQ flagging, back-calculated standard recovery (80–120% acceptance), Method Health quality panel. - **Dose-Response**: IC50/EC50 with 95% CI, Hill slope, asymptotes, normalisation to controls, Z′ factor, multi-compound comparison, extrapolation warnings. - **Parallel Line Analysis (PLA)**: joint constrained 4PL/5PL fit, parallelism F-test, lack-of-fit test, Grubbs outlier screening, relative potency (RP%) with Fieller and bootstrap 95% CI, multi-run geometric combination with forest plot — per Ph. Eur. 5.3 and USP <1032>/<1034>. - **Kinetic / Group Comparison**: automatic time-axis detection from plate-reader exports, Vmax, initial rate, AUC (trapezoidal), endpoint reduction, then t-test / Mann-Whitney / ANOVA + Tukey or Dunnett / Kruskal-Wallis + Dunn with Cohen's d and significance brackets. - **Ecotoxicology — risk**: EDI = (C × IR) / BW, THQ = EDI / RfD, HI = ΣTHQ, target cancer risk TR = EDI × CSF, batch mode, THQ heatmap, Monte Carlo probabilistic analysis, built-in RfD/CSF defaults for 23 trace elements. - **Ecotoxicology — pollution**: CF, PLI (geometric mean), Igeo = log₂(C / 1.5B), enrichment factor, MPI, with contamination-tier classification. - **Ecotoxicology — bioaccumulation**: BSAF, BAF, LOD/2 imputation. - **Ecotoxicology — biometrics**: Fulton's K = 100·W/L³, HSI, GSI and related condition indices.
